How Our Water Heater Burst Water Removal Process Works

When you call us for water heater burst water removal, our team will follow a specific process to ensure your property is restored to its pre-damage condition. Here’s what you can expect:

Step 1: Assessment and Planning

We’ll send a technician to your property to assess the damage and create a customized plan for water removal and restoration. Our team will use specialized equipment to detect hidden moisture and identify areas that need attention. Within 60 minutes, we’ll have a clear plan in place to get your property back to normal.

Step 2: Water Removal and Extraction

Our team will use powerful pumps and vacuum equipment to remove standing water from your property. We’ll also use specialized equipment to extract water from carpets, upholstery, and other materials. This step is critical to preventing further damage and ensuring your property is safe and dry.

Step 3: Drying and Dehumidification

Once the water is removed, our team will use specialized equipment to dry out your property. This includes using desiccants, dehumidifiers, and fans to remove excess moisture and prevent mold growth. Our team will also use thermal imaging cameras to detect hidden moisture and ensure your property is completely dry.

Step 4: Cleaning and Sanitizing

After the water is removed and your property is dry, our team will clean and sanitize all surfaces to prevent mold and bacterial growth. This includes using specialized cleaning solutions and equipment to remove dirt, grime, and other contaminants.

Step 5: Restoration and Reconstruction

Once your property is clean and dry, our team will work with you to restore and reconstruct any damaged areas. This may include replacing carpets, upholstery, and drywall, as well as repairing or replacing any damaged structural elements.

Water Heater Burst Water Removal Cost in Hoffman, OK

The cost of water heater burst water removal in Hoffman, OK will depend on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ions. Here are some estimated costs for common scenarios:

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Water removal and extraction $500 – $2,500 Size of affected area, type of materials damaged
Drying and dehumidification $200 – $1,000 Size of affected area, type of materials damaged
Cleaning and sanitizing $100 – $500 Size of affected area, type of materials damaged
Restoration and reconstruction $1,000 – $5,000 Size of affected area, type of materials damaged
Insurance claims help $0 – $500 Complexity of claims process, type of insurance coverage

Keep in mind that these are estimated costs and may vary depending on the specifics of your situation. Our team will work with you to provide a detailed estimate and help you navigate the claims process.
